Montgomery County Man Charged With Sex Trafficking 16-Year-Old

LANSDALE, P.A., (CBS) – A Montgomery County man is charged with the human-trafficking of a 16-year-old girl.

Authorities say 32-year-old Brian Kieffer began an inappropriate relationship with her after the pair met on a social media app last August. After meeting, authorities say he managed and profited off her prostitution.

Authorities say he allegedly also drove the girl around to purchase paraphernalia such as heroin and cocaine. Officials say he allegedly took her to Florida in October without her parents' knowledge or consent. That's where authorities say they caught the two after the teen's parents reported her missing.

After his initial arrest in October, he has been held on $1 million bail. On Wednesday, he was arraigned on additional charges raising his bail to $5 million.

Officials say the new charges follow a joint investigation by Montgomery County Detectives.

Montgomery County District Attorney Kevin Steele says Kieffer is facing 40 felony counts related to prostitution and human trafficking and could face a maximum of 411 years in prison.
